The application fee of ALNAT exam is INR 999. The application fee can be paid online using a credit card, debit card, internet banking or UPI. The candidates have to pay the ALNAT application fee in order to complete the ALNAT application process. Candidates can register themselves on the official website of ALNAT and pay the application fee.

The Altera National Aptitude Test (ANAT) is typically conducted online with a duration of 120 minutes. It consists of multiple-choice questions (MCQs) divided into sections such as Quantitative Acumen, Critical Reasoning, Comprehension Skills, and Business Intelligence. The total number of questions are 70. Each question carries a specific number of marks, and there may be negative marking for incorrect answers. The exam is conducted in English.

To apply for the Altera National Aptitude Test (ALNAT), cadidates need to visit the official Altera Institute website and register as a new user. Fill out the online application form with your personal and academic details, and upload the required documents, such as a passport-sized photograph, signature, and relevant certificates. After completing the form, pay the application fee online through available payment methods like credit/debit cards or net banking. Review all the information for accuracy before submitting the form. Once submitted, download and print the confirmation page for your records.

The Altera National Aptitude Test (ANAT) is an entrance examination conducted by Altera Institute of Management. It is designed to assess the aptitude and academic potential of candidates seeking admission to PGP in Applied Marketing programme. The ANAT exam typically evaluates a candidate's proficiency in areas such as Quantitative Aptitude, Logical Reasoning, Verbal Ability, and General Knowledge, depending on the programme for which they are applying.
